Key Responsibilities

  • Lead defined process design tasks or work packages across feasibility, optioneering, concept, outline and detailed design.
  • Prepare, check and coordinate process deliverables including:
    • Calculations
    • Mass balances
    • PFDs
    • P&IDs
    • Basis of design reports
    • Specifications
    • Datasheets
    • Schedules
  • Take ownership of assigned process packages, managing:
    • Technical quality
    • Interfaces
    • Scope
    • Budget
    • Programme
    • Change
  • Lead site surveys, data reviews, and technical discussions with:
    • Clients
    • Operators
    • Suppliers
    • Contractors
  • Develop treatment process options and support selection of efficient, robust and operable solutions.
  • Coordinate process interfaces with Mechanical, EICA, civil/structural, architectural, MEP and construction teams.
  • Support:
    • HAZOP
    • SWIFT
    • DSEAR
    • HAC/HAP
    • CDM/safety-by-design reviews
    • Commissioning strategies
    • Performance testing
  • Apply process modelling, simulation, spreadsheets and data analysis to improve design quality and support evidence-based decisions.
  • Review supplier/contractor submissions, respond to technical queries and support construction, commissioning and handover where required.
  • Mentor Engineers and Graduates and contribute to:
    • Process standards
    • Templates
    • Delivery improvements

Requirements

Minimum Requirements

  • BEng/MEng or equivalent in:

    • Chemical Engineering
    • Process Engineering
    • Closely related discipline
  • Chartered Engineer (CEng) status, or significant CEng-level experience while actively progressing towards chartership.

  • Typically 6+ years’ relevant process design experience.

  • Background must be from water, wastewater and/or biosolids/sludge treatment design.

  • Proven ability to deliver process design packages within multidisciplinary projects.

  • Strong practical experience preparing and checking:

    • Process calculations
    • Mass balances
    • PFDs
    • P&IDs
    • Basis of design reports
    • Specifications
    • Technical documentation
  • Working knowledge of:

    • UK water industry standards
    • CDM 2015
    • Process safety
    • Safety-by-design
    • Relevant regulatory requirements
  • Experience using process modelling/simulation, advanced spreadsheets, or data-led design methods to support treatment design.

  • Good commercial awareness and ability to deliver to agreed:

    • Scope
    • Budget
    • Programme
  • Strong communication skills, including ability to:

    • Lead technical discussions
    • Present recommendations clearly

Desirable Skills / Knowledge

  • Practical experience using:
    • BioWin
    • SUMO
    • Dynamizu
    • Similar water/wastewater process simulation packages
  • Experience with:
    • AMP8
    • WINEP
    • SROs
    • D&B
    • Framework, alliance or major capital delivery environments
  • Experience in:
    • Nutrient removal
    • Sludge/bioresources
    • Water reuse
    • Process optimisation
    • Chemical dosing
    • Energy recovery
    • Advanced treatment
    • Low-carbon design
  • Experience supporting:
    • Commissioning
    • Performance testing
    • HAZOPs
    • SWIFT reviews
    • Technical assurance reviews
  • Experience mentoring junior staff and improving:
    • Process workflows
    • Templates
    • Technical standards
